The latest IMF report once again proves that the Iran conflict has not only caused heavy casualties and losses, but also severe spillover effects that are hampering global economic growth and the improvement of people's wellbeing, Chinese foreign ministry spokesperson Guo Jiakun said on Wednesday at a regular press briefing in Beijing.
